您的位置 首页 程序设计

编程安全要点:语言规范、函数调用与变量管理防护策略

编程安全的核心在于遵循语言规范,这不仅有助于代码的可读性,还能减少潜在的安全漏洞。每种编程语言都有其特定的规则和最佳实践,例如避免使用不安全的函数或方法,如C语言中的strcpy,应优先使用更安全的替代方案。

函数调用时需注意参数的合法性与类型检查,防止因错误的数据类型导致程序崩溃或执行非预期操作。在调用第三方库或系统函数时,应确保其来源可靠,并定期更新以修复已知漏洞。

变量管理是保障程序稳定性的关键环节。应避免使用全局变量过多,尤其是敏感数据,尽量通过参数传递或封装方式处理。同时,变量命名应清晰明确,避免歧义,减少因误用引发的错误。

AI图片,仅供参考

在处理用户输入时,必须进行严格的验证和过滤,防止注入攻击等常见安全问题。例如,对字符串进行转义处理,或使用参数化查询来保护数据库访问。

定期进行代码审查和安全测试,能够及时发现并修复潜在问题。结合静态分析工具和动态测试手段,可以有效提升代码的整体安全性。

关于作者: dawei

【声明】:金华站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

热门文章

发表回复